x86/microcode/AMD: Track patch allocation size explicitly



[ Upstream commit 712f210a457d9c32414df246a72781550bc23ef6 ]

In preparation for reducing the use of ksize(), record the actual
allocation size for later memcpy(). This avoids copying extra
(uninitialized!) bytes into the patch buffer when the requested
allocation size isn't exactly the size of a kmalloc bucket.
Additionally, fix potential future issues where runtime bounds checking
will notice that the buffer was allocated to a smaller value than
returned by ksize().
